Interesting Facts about Middletown, NJ
- History has in it that Middletown is a city with roots rooted in the 1600s. From museums to historical monuments, every building echoes about the past that is settled in its boundaries. From then to now, Middletown has developed as an active suburb joint. There are many places, like the Navesink River and Bay of Sandy Hook, where the landscape is a beauty to the eyes. With this scenic beauty, there’s a high demand for these places.
- Look up any article or blog, and one will often find the name of Middletown described as one of the best places to live in. Opportunities abound and the homes are immaculate.
- Wealthy and luxurious, the city also has a very prosperous population.
- The Jersey shore is close to Middletown, and hence the availability of resources and employment will also be accessible here.
These are just some of the interesting facts about Middleton that make it a great place to live.
